Theoretical limiting resolution of optical system: The rayleigh criterion for the diffraction limit to resolution states that two images are just resolvable when the center of the diffraction pattern of one is directly over the first minimum of the diffraction pattern of the other.

Resolving power is defined as the inverse of the distance or angular separation between two objects which can be resolved through the optical instrument. Resolution in a perfect optical system can be described mathematically by abbe's equation. D = _0.612 * l_ n sin a.
